Definition of subzero

1 : registering less than zero on some scale (especially the Fahrenheit scale) subzero temperatures
2 : characterized by or suitable for subzero temperatures subzero winters sub-zero snow boots Here the altitude was almost a mile and a half above sea level and there was already hard frost in the mornings. With the first storm, the mornings would be subzero.— Tony Hillerman

First Known Use of subzero

1887 , in the meaning defined at sense 1
